Descriptions & Requirements
This is a pivotal leadership role, joining a small and collaborative executive team committed to delivering OPG’s strategy of being customer focussed, innovating and modernising together. This role is critical in shaping and delivering OPG strategic roadmap, driving forward OPG’s transformation portfolio, developing customer insight capabilities and supporting change and innovation throughout OPG, along with making sure OPG has the capability and capacity for the future.
Key Responsibilities Reporting into the Public Guardian and Chief Executive, you will:
- Ensure the delivery of OPG’s transformation portfolio, including Modernising Lasting Powers of Attorney which is critical to OPG’s longer-term financial stability and improving customer experience and outcomes.
- Develop and implement OPG’s Target Operating Model and Strategic Workforce Plan, including planning for and delivering significant people change.
- Set clear strategic direction for OPG, along with development of the roadmap to deliver OPG’s strategy.
- Strengthen customer insight and experience to drive evidence-based decision making and improved services.
- Champion innovation, including drawing together initiatives that test and embed AI in OPG.
- Strengthen and promote the reputation of OPG across government and externally.
- Be a visible, approachable and authentic leader as part of the Executive team, building a positive and engaged culture, and nurture resilient and well-functioning teams.
- Provide challenge, support and scrutiny as a member of OPG Executive Committee, Portfolio and Change Board, and wider OPG governance.
- As part of the senior leadership team, support OPG through a period of significant change and be adaptable to changing responsibilities.

Essential Experience:
- Experience of leading and setting direction for large, diverse teams with oversight of a broad portfolio of work, including building and empowering resilient teams able to prioritise and adapt to new challenges.
- Experience of strategic development and delivery – experience of turning ambition into achievements.
- Experience of being part of a leadership team managing an organisation through significant change and transformation to achieve better quality service for customers.
- Able to work collaboratively across organisational lines to achieve shared objectives by developing excellent relationships.
- Proven experience of gripping complex issues, setting clear priorities and delivering through others to agreed timescales.
